GitHub个人博客如何修改:全面指南

在当今数字化时代,个人博客不仅是分享知识的平台,更是个人品牌的体现。许多人选择在GitHub上搭建个人博客,但在创建之后,可能会面临许多需要修改的地方。本文将详细讲解如何有效地修改你的GitHub个人博客,包括主题更改、内容更新和布局调整等。

1. GitHub个人博客基础知识

在了解如何修改之前,我们首先需要明确GitHub个人博客的基本构建方式。GitHub Pages是GitHub提供的一项服务,可以让用户利用其存储库(repository)创建个人网页。你可以通过选择不同的静态网站生成器(如Jekyll)来构建个人博客。

1.1 GitHub Pages简介

  • 免费托管:GitHub Pages允许用户免费托管静态网页。
  • 自定义域名:用户可以将自定义域名与GitHub Pages关联。
  • 版本控制:由于博客是以代码形式存在,用户可以利用Git进行版本控制,轻松管理更新。

1.2 Jekyll和其他静态网站生成器

  • Jekyll:最受欢迎的静态网站生成器,完美支持GitHub Pages。
  • HexoHugo等:其他优秀的静态网站生成器,用户可以根据需求选择。

2. 修改个人博客主题

2.1 选择主题

修改主题是个性化个人博客的第一步。GitHub提供了多种免费主题,用户可以在GitHub主题页面上查看。

选择主题的步骤:

  1. 访问主题库。
  2. 浏览并选择适合自己风格的主题。
  3. 将主题文件下载到本地。

2.2 应用主题

要在GitHub上应用新的主题,按照以下步骤操作:

  • 修改配置文件:在你的博客仓库中,找到 _config.yml 文件,修改其中的 theme 属性,设置为你选择的主题。
  • 提交更改:将修改提交到主分支,GitHub会自动更新你的博客。

3. 更新博客内容

更新内容是维护个人博客的关键。下面是一些更新内容的技巧:

3.1 撰写新文章

  • 使用Markdown:大多数博客使用Markdown格式撰写文章,确保了解其语法。
  • 定期更新:设定一个写作计划,保持博客内容的新鲜。

3.2 编辑已有文章

  • 在GitHub上找到你想编辑的文章,直接在线编辑。
  • 更新后,别忘了提交更改。

4. 调整博客布局

4.1 自定义布局文件

  • 布局文件位置:在 /_layouts 文件夹下,查找并修改现有的布局文件。
  • HTML/CSS基础:若要更改布局,需具备一定的HTML和CSS基础。

4.2 添加自定义组件

  • 在你的博客中添加自定义组件,比如侧边栏、社交媒体链接等。
  • 通过直接修改布局文件,实现更多个性化功能。

5. 常见问题解答(FAQ)

如何在GitHub上创建个人博客?

  • 在GitHub上新建一个仓库,命名为username.github.io(替换username为你的用户名)。选择Jekyll主题并进行必要的设置。通过在此仓库内添加Markdown文件,逐步建立你的博客内容。

GitHub个人博客如何选择主题?

  • 你可以在GitHub Pages主题页面中查看各种主题,选择一个符合你审美和需求的主题。查看主题的文档,了解如何安装和应用。

如何发布新的博客文章?

  • 在你的博客仓库中创建一个新的Markdown文件,并按照约定命名(通常是YYYY-MM-DD-title.md格式)。在文件顶部添加必要的元数据(如标题、日期等),然后提交到仓库。

GitHub个人博客如何自定义域名?

  • 在你的仓库中创建一个名为CNAME的文件,并在其中填写你的自定义域名。接着,前往你的域名注册商网站,设置DNS记录指向GitHub的IP地址。最后,保存更改并等待生效。

如何备份我的GitHub博客?

  • 使用Git命令行工具将你的仓库克隆到本地,这样你就有了一个完整的备份。在需要时,可以轻松恢复。

6. 总结

修改GitHub个人博客不仅是个性化的重要一步,也是展示个人风格的绝佳方式。无论是选择新主题、更新内容,还是调整布局,都需要不断探索和尝试。希望本指南能够帮助你顺利地修改你的GitHub个人博客,让它成为你个人品牌的有力支撑。

正文完